How much does it cost to rent a home in Outer Aventura?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Outer Aventura 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,318 | $1,600 | $10,000+ |
| Outer Aventura 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,553 | $2,100 | $10,000+ |
| Outer Aventura 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$8,714 | $3,600 | $10,000+ |
| Outer Aventura 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$16,399 | $5,950 | $10,000+ |
| Outer Aventura 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$31,700 | $5,100 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Outer Aventura
What type of rentals are currently available in Outer Aventura?
There are currently 298 Apartments for Rent in Outer Aventura, FL with pricing that ranges from $1,000 to $27,234. There are also 637 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Outer Aventura ranging from $1,000 to $75,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Outer Aventura?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Outer Aventura ranges from $1,000 to $75,000 with an average monthly rent of $15,361.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Outer Aventura?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Outer Aventura range from $3,236 to $6,000,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$2,100 to $25,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$3,600 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$6,408.
